Transaction 43a27eb47b0e62223546da49b6e340453d3a85b1bccc921f7480ce7261548747

2 Input
2 Outputs
  • 43a27eb47b0e62223546da49b6e340453d3a85b1bccc921f7480ce7261548747:0
  • value  467710
    address  1CaVuT5mdWPzn8FRB6vjERAa84w4Ekc7pE
  • 43a27eb47b0e62223546da49b6e340453d3a85b1bccc921f7480ce7261548747:1
  • value  20000000
    address  3QXyvtv43pqv3ZRonK7UTUtLCB876LLPeF